## ABSOLUTE REQUIREMENT

Before claiming ANY of the following, you MUST provide evidence:

### 1. "Tests pass"
**MUST run:** `mix test`
**MUST read:** Actual test output showing "X tests, 0 failures"
**MUST provide:** Exact output or test count

```bash
# Required evidence
$ mix test
..........

Finished in 0.3 seconds (0.1s async, 0.2s sync)
10 tests, 0 failures

# This is evidence ✓
```

### 2. "Code compiles"
**MUST run:** `mix compile --warnings-as-errors`
**MUST read:** Output showing "Compiled" or error messages
**MUST provide:** Confirmation of zero warnings

```bash
# Required evidence
$ mix compile --warnings-as-errors
Compiling 5 files (.ex)
Generated my_app app

# This is evidence ✓
```

### 3. "Code is formatted"
**MUST run:** `mix format --check-formatted`
**MUST read:** Output or lack thereof
**MUST provide:** Confirmation no files would be formatted

```bash
# Required evidence
$ mix format --check-formatted
# (no output means all files formatted)

# This is evidence ✓
```

### 4. "Credo passes"
**MUST run:** `mix credo --strict`
**MUST read:** Analysis results
**MUST provide:** Confirmation of "no issues found"

```bash
# Required evidence
$ mix credo --strict
Checking 42 source files...

Please report incorrect results: https://github.com/rrrene/credo/issues

Analysis took 0.3 seconds (0.2s to load, 0.1s running 100 checks on 42 files)
17 mods/funs, found no issues.

# This is evidence ✓
```

### 5. "Dialyzer passes"
**MUST run:** `mix dialyzer`
**MUST read:** Type checking results
**MUST provide:** "done (passed successfully)" message

```bash
# Required evidence
$ mix dialyzer
...
Total errors: 0, Skipped: 0, Unnecessary Skips: 0
done (passed successfully)

# This is evidence ✓
```

### 6. "Migration runs successfully"
**MUST run:** `mix ecto.migrate`
**MUST read:** Migration execution output
**MUST provide:** Confirmation migration completed

```bash
# Required evidence
$ mix ecto.migrate

15:42:13.456 [info] == Running 20231201150000 MyApp.Repo.Migrations.CreateUsers.change/0 forward

15:42:13.458 [info] create table users

15:42:13.478 [info] == Migrated 20231201150000 in 0.0s

# This is evidence ✓
```

### 7. "Function works correctly"
**MUST run:** Test that exercises the function
**MUST read:** Test output showing it passes
**MUST provide:** Example usage or test code

```elixir
# Required evidence
test "create_user/1 with valid attrs creates user" do
  attrs = %{name: "Alice", email: "alice@example.com"}
  assert {:ok, %User{} = user} = Accounts.create_user(attrs)
  assert user.name == "Alice"
  assert user.email == "alice@example.com"
end

# ✓ Test passes with actual run
```

### 8. "Issue is fixed"
**MUST run:** The command that revealed the issue
**MUST read:** Output showing issue no longer appears
**MUST provide:** Before/after comparison

```bash
# Required evidence - BEFORE
$ mix dialyzer
lib/my_app.ex:42:pattern_can_never_match
Total errors: 1

# Applied fix...

# Required evidence - AFTER
$ mix dialyzer
Total errors: 0, Skipped: 0, Unnecessary Skips: 0
done (passed successfully)

# This is evidence ✓
```

## WHEN VERIFICATION FAILS

If you run a command and it fails:

### DO NOT:
- Claim it works anyway
- Say "it should work, not sure why it's failing"
- Move on to other tasks
- Assume the failure is environmental

### INSTEAD:
1. **Read the error message completely**
2. **Understand what failed and why**
3. **Fix the actual problem**
4. **Run the command again**
5. **Verify it now passes**
6. **Provide evidence of success**

## VERIFICATION WORKFLOW

**For EVERY change you make:**

### 1. Make the change
```elixir
# Edit code
def create_user(attrs) do
  # ... implementation
end
```

### 2. Run the relevant test
```bash
$ mix test test/my_app/accounts_test.exs:42
.

Finished in 0.1 seconds
1 test, 0 failures
```

### 3. Run full test suite
```bash
$ mix test
..........

Finished in 0.3 seconds
10 tests, 0 failures
```

### 4. Run quality checks
```bash
$ mix format --check-formatted
$ mix credo --strict
$ mix dialyzer
```

### 5. Report results
```
✓ Tests pass (10/10)
✓ Code formatted
✓ Credo: no issues
✓ Dialyzer: 0 errors
```

**Only THEN can you claim the task is complete.**

## SPECIAL CASES

### "I can't run tests because..."
**STOP.** Fix the environment so you CAN run tests. Testing is non-negotiable.

### "The tests are flaky"
**STOP.** Fix the flakiness before proceeding. Flaky tests = broken tests.

### "Dialyzer takes too long"
**Run it anyway.** Cache the PLT. Use `mix dialyzer --incremental`. No shortcuts.

### "I'm just writing documentation"
**Still verify.** Run `mix docs` and confirm it generates without warnings.

### "It's just a comment change"
**Still verify.** Run `mix format --check-formatted` and ensure formatting is maintained.
